Juicing - The Benefits to Your Health

All your life you have heard people say, "Eat your fruits and vegetables." It has been known for years that fruits and vegetables have great nutritional value and can improve your health as part of a daily diet.

Recently juicing fruits and vegetables has become quite popular for many people wanting to improve their health. You may be wondering what is so great about juicing the vegetables and fruits and you may think that doing so would be a lot of trouble, but the benefits of juicing far outweigh the time you might spend on the task.

There are so many great vitamins and minerals found in fruits and vegetables, but many times you cannot consume enough to get the amount of the vitamins and minerals your body needs. This is where juicing comes in! When you juice the fruits and vegetables you can drink the juice of large quantities of them and get more of the nutrients that are needed.

Making the Juice

Juicing fruits and vegetables can actually sound more complicated than it actually is. More than likely you won't want to juice by hand, since that would take awhile. But there are great pieces of technology that can help you juice simply and quickly.

You can purchase juicers that will juice the fruits and vegetables for you or you can get a good blender that will produce close to the same effect. If you do choose the blender, the juices will be thicker since you will still have all the fibers of the fruit or vegetables.

If you prefer to have the juice and fibers separate, you may want to go ahead and invest in a quality juicer. Some of the juicers can be quite expensive, but you will be able to use them every single day to help improve your health.

A juicer actually mashes up the fruits or vegetables and then separates the juices from the fibers of the fruit or vegetable. When you choose your juicer, make sure that you pick one that will last and that will produce the best juice. Spending a bit more money may be worth it in the long run if your juicer lasts longer.

Nutritional Benefits

Juicing provides many great nutritional benefits that you cannot get even if you eat your servings of fruit and vegetables each day. Fruits and vegetables provide great vitamins and minerals as well as chemicals that not only help improve health, but also may protect the body from problems like heart disease and certain cancers.

There are also enzymes in fruits in vegetables that your body needs to function properly. These enzymes can help your body heal itself as well as keeping it in the best shape possible.

It would be impossible for you to get all the nutrients, minerals and enzymes you really need just by eating fruit and vegetables daily. When you juice the fruits and vegetables you can take advantage of all the great nutrients without having to eat them in large portions.

If you were to take one glass of carrot juice and the nutrients that are in that one glass, you would have to eat an entire pound of carrots to get the same amount of nutrients. You probably do not want to eat a pound of carrots each day, but drinking a glass of the juice makes getting those essential nutrients much easier.

Juicing is not something that you want to take up as some kind of fad diet, but it is a life change that is important for the rest of your life. There are so many great benefits to juicing that will lead to weight loss, a healthy body and even preventing illnesses.

It is important that you juice every day and make sure your body gets the nutrients it needs. Hit and miss juicing will probably not improve your health that much, but if you change your lifestyle to include juicing each day you will be able to reap the great benefits that juicing provides.
